Gerrard has his feet on the ground

Steven Gerrard has warned his Liverpool team-mates not to get carried away with their strong start to the season.

Liverpool are undefeated in the Premier League and in second place after winning 2-0 at Everton, their best start in 12 years.

But with the Champions League clash with PSV Eindhoven coming up on Wednesday, Gerrard said: "It's important to be humble and to keep out feet on the ground.

"We set a standard [at Everton] but we need to match it week in, week out."

A Fernando Torres double proved the difference at Goodison Park and Gerrard was delighted to see the Spaniard back to his best.

He said: "You can't keep strikers with his talent down for long because they aren't going to go long without a goal. It was only a matter of time."
